What will the house of tomorrow look like?
La Rédaction | 05/30/2017
|
Innovation & Tools
Although home-building is one of the oldest trades in the world, it bears remarkable energy for innovation. Around the world, research and development labs are working on improving our abodes in all ways, designing homes that will be more affordable, more secure, with better energetic performance....

Middle East learns about waste management
The Strategist | 04/20/2015
|
Markets & Industries
The Middle-East is ending its demographic transition. This means population will remain relatively stable from now on, but the transition has caused a dramatic increase in the people’s number. Developing industries have complicated the ecological situation further. Now that the region has flourished, comes the price-tag: dealing with the increased amount of waste, generated every day.
